About us

MKS Instruments enables technologies that transform our world. We deliver foundational technology solutions to leading edge semiconductor manufacturing, electronics and packaging, and specialty industrial applications. We apply our broad science and engineering capabilities to create instruments, subsystems, systems, process control solutions and specialty chemicals technology that improve process performance, optimize productivity and enable unique innovations for many of the world’s leading technology and industrial companies. Our solutions are critical to addressing the challenges of miniaturization and complexity in advanced device manufacturing by enabling increased power, speed, feature enhancement, and optimized connectivity. Our solutions are also critical to addressing ever-increasing performance requirements across a wide array of specialty industrial applications. Additional information can be found at www.mks.com.

    My Innovation Story - Narathorn Nisab Our unwavering commitment to innovation not only transformed our laboratory but also revolutionized our customers' operations. At our Customer Service Laboratory in Thailand, we meticulously monitor the plating process using various chemical and physical tests. Through this observation, we pinpointed areas for enhancement. Notably, manual titration with a visual indicator emerged as one such area. We came together as a team, working closely not only within our lab but also alongside our worldwide Chemical & Physical Characterization team, service engineers and customers. We shared the same mission: find a better way to perform titration. After thorough research and exploration, we introduced potentiometric titration with an automatic system into our workflow. This turned out to be a valuable approach that offered precision, efficiency, and time savings. However, we didn't stop there. We conducted in-house training for our customers who embraced our new approach because it promised to lead to increased productivity and decreased inaccuracies. We did our part as a trusted partner.
